Popis: We experimentally show novel phenomena: (1) in the same double slit or cross double slit experiment, within macroscopic distances from diaphragm, the patterns are non-interference and gradually evolve to the interference patterns near the screen; (2) in the same single slit or cross single slit experiment, within macroscopic distances from diaphragm, the patterns are nondiffraction and gradually evolve to the diffraction patterns near the screen; (3) in the same non-parallel-two-slits experiment, within macroscopic distances from diaphragm, the patterns are diffraction and gradually evolve to the diffraction-interferencehybrid patterns; (4) the diffraction-interference hybrid patterns are angle-dependence. To interpret consistently above phenomena is the challenge to the existing wave theories of the physical optics. Advances in optical experiments demand new theory
